Single-cell RNA Sequencing dissects cellular phenotypes linked to dysregulated mucosal wound healing in diabetes and aging
Ontology highlight
ABSTRACT: Aging and diabetes exert a disruptive wound healing process. We use single-cell RNA-sequencing (scRNA-seq) data from palatal oral wounds in young, aged and diabetic mice to investigate immune and stromal cells heterogeneity to understand their role in wound repair.
ORGANISM(S): Mus musculus
